paternity testing is a scientific method used to determine whether a man is the biological father of a child. This process is essential for various reasons, including legal matters, medical reasons, and personal peace of mind. With advancements in technology, paternity testing has become more accurate and accessible than ever before. In this article, we will explore the importance of paternity testing and how it can benefit individuals and families.

One of the primary reasons for conducting paternity testing is to establish legal parentage. In cases of child support, custody battles, and inheritance disputes, knowing the biological father of a child is crucial. A paternity test provides concrete evidence that can be used in court to resolve legal matters and ensure that the child receives the support and care they deserve. Without accurate paternity testing, false claims of parentage can lead to emotional and financial turmoil for all parties involved.

In addition to legal matters, paternity testing can also have significant medical implications. Knowing a child’s biological father can be essential for understanding and addressing potential genetic risks. Some hereditary conditions are passed down from parent to child, and knowing the genetic history of both parents can help healthcare providers make informed decisions about the child’s health and well-being. By identifying potential genetic risks early on, parents can take proactive steps to prevent or manage health issues in their children.

Furthermore, paternity testing can provide emotional peace of mind for families. In cases where there is doubt or uncertainty about a child’s paternity, a paternity test can put an end to speculation and provide clarity for all parties involved. Knowing the truth about parentage can strengthen family bonds and create a sense of stability and security for everyone. Moreover, paternity testing can help foster open and honest communication within families, as it encourages individuals to confront difficult truths and work together to address any challenges that may arise.
